Lean Manufacturing Principles: Enhancing Efficiency and Reducing Waste

Introduction

Lean manufacturing is a systematic approach to minimizing waste while maximizing productivity. Originating from the Toyota Production System (TPS), lean principles focus on improving efficiency, reducing costs, and enhancing product quality. By adopting lean manufacturing techniques, businesses can streamline operations, optimize resource use, and continuously improve their processes. Four key principles of lean manufacturing include Just-in-Time (JIT), 5S Methodology, Kaizen, and Total Productive Maintenance (TPM). Each of these plays a crucial role in eliminating inefficiencies and promoting a culture of continuous improvement.

Just-in-Time (JIT): Reducing Inventory and Improving Efficiency

What is JIT?

Just-in-Time (JIT) is a production strategy aimed at reducing inventory levels by producing only what is needed, when it’s needed, and in the exact quantity required. The goal is to eliminate waste associated with excess inventory, storage costs, and obsolete products. JIT ensures that resources, materials, and labor are efficiently allocated, leading to cost savings and increased efficiency.

Key Benefits of JIT

  • Lower Inventory Costs – By keeping only necessary stock, businesses reduce storage costs and minimize waste from unsold goods.
  • Improved Cash Flow – Less capital is tied up in unused inventory, freeing up funds for investment in other business areas.
  • Enhanced Product Quality – Producing only what is needed ensures quality control at each stage, reducing defects and rework.
  • Faster Response to Market Changes – JIT allows businesses to adapt quickly to customer demands and industry trends.

Implementing JIT in Manufacturing

  1. Supplier Coordination – Establishing strong relationships with reliable suppliers ensures timely delivery of materials.
  2. Demand Forecasting – Using data analytics and market research to predict customer demand accurately.
  3. Production Scheduling – Creating flexible and responsive production schedules to align with demand fluctuations.
  4. Workforce Training – Educating employees on JIT principles to promote efficiency and reduce errors.

Challenges of JIT

  • Supply Chain Disruptions – Any delays from suppliers can halt production.
  • Demand Variability – Sudden changes in demand may lead to production inefficiencies.
  • Initial Implementation Costs – Transitioning to JIT may require investments in technology and employee training.

Despite these challenges, businesses that successfully implement JIT benefit from leaner operations and improved competitiveness.

5S Methodology: Organizing the Workspace for Maximum Productivity

What is 5S?

The 5S methodology is a workplace organization system that focuses on cleanliness, order, and efficiency. It consists of five key steps:

  1. Sort (Seiri) – Remove unnecessary items from the workspace to reduce clutter and improve focus.
  2. Set in Order (Seiton) – Arrange necessary tools and materials for easy access, reducing wasted time.
  3. Shine (Seiso) – Clean and inspect the workplace regularly to maintain safety and efficiency.
  4. Standardize (Seiketsu) – Develop standardized procedures to sustain the first three steps.
  5. Sustain (Shitsuke) – Create a culture of continuous improvement by training employees and enforcing 5S practices.

Benefits of 5S Implementation

  • Increased Productivity – A well-organized workspace allows employees to work efficiently and reduces wasted time.
  • Improved Safety – Clean and organized work areas reduce the risk of accidents.
  • Better Morale – Employees feel more engaged in a well-maintained and efficient environment.
  • Higher Quality Standards – Standardized processes minimize errors and inconsistencies.

Steps to Implement 5S

  1. Conduct a workplace audit to identify areas for improvement.
  2. Train employees on the importance of 5S principles.
  3. Implement sorting and organization strategies.
  4. Establish cleaning and maintenance routines.
  5. Develop and enforce standardized procedures for consistency.
  6. Encourage continuous monitoring and improvement.

By maintaining an organized and systematic workspace, companies can enhance workflow efficiency and eliminate unnecessary waste.

Kaizen: Encouraging Continuous Improvement

What is Kaizen?

Kaizen, a Japanese term meaning “continuous improvement,” is a lean philosophy that encourages all employees, from top management to frontline workers, to contribute small, incremental improvements to processes. The idea is that minor enhancements, when applied consistently, lead to significant long-term gains in productivity, efficiency, and quality.

Principles of Kaizen

  • Teamwork – Encouraging collaboration between departments and employees at all levels.
  • Personal Discipline – Promoting accountability and responsibility for improvement.
  • Improved Morale – Fostering a culture where employees feel valued and motivated to contribute ideas.
  • Quality Circles – Small groups of employees regularly meet to discuss improvements in their work areas.

Benefits of Kaizen Implementation

  • Enhanced Efficiency – Eliminating unnecessary steps and optimizing processes.
  • Reduced Costs – Identifying waste and implementing cost-saving measures.
  • Greater Employee Engagement – Empowering workers to take ownership of improvements.
  • Increased Customer Satisfaction – Delivering better quality products and services through continuous refinements.

Steps to Implement Kaizen

  1. Identify areas for improvement through employee feedback and performance analysis.
  2. Form small teams (quality circles) to brainstorm solutions.
  3. Implement small-scale changes and measure their impact.
  4. Refine and standardize successful improvements.
  5. Encourage a continuous cycle of evaluation and enhancement.

By fostering a culture of continuous improvement, Kaizen helps businesses remain adaptable and competitive in a dynamic market.

Total Productive Maintenance (TPM): Ensuring Equipment Reliability

What is TPM?

Total Productive Maintenance (TPM) is a proactive maintenance strategy designed to maximize equipment reliability and efficiency. Unlike traditional maintenance, which focuses on repairing breakdowns, TPM emphasizes preventing failures before they occur.

Pillars of TPM

  1. Autonomous Maintenance – Encouraging operators to take responsibility for basic maintenance tasks, such as cleaning and inspections.
  2. Planned Maintenance – Scheduling regular maintenance activities to prevent unexpected breakdowns.
  3. Quality Maintenance – Using root cause analysis to eliminate defects and ensure consistent product quality.
  4. Focused Improvement – Identifying areas where productivity can be enhanced through process optimization.
  5. Education and Training – Providing employees with the knowledge and skills needed for effective maintenance.

Benefits of TPM Implementation

  • Reduced Downtime – Preventative maintenance reduces unplanned stoppages.
  • Lower Maintenance Costs – Addressing small issues early prevents costly major repairs.
  • Improved Productivity – Equipment operates at optimal performance levels, increasing output.
  • Enhanced Workplace Safety – Regular maintenance ensures machines function safely.

Steps to Implement TPM

  1. Train employees on the importance of TPM and their role in maintenance.
  2. Establish maintenance schedules and standard operating procedures.
  3. Encourage operator-led inspections and minor repairs.
  4. Use data analytics to predict maintenance needs and optimize scheduling.
  5. Continuously refine maintenance processes based on performance metrics.

By integrating TPM into lean manufacturing, organizations can improve operational reliability and efficiency, ultimately leading to cost savings and higher production output.
